Add a Full Proxy User

The Course Reserves system allows instructors to grant full proxy access for their courses to another user.  Any user with full proxy access will be able to request course reserves, edit reserves, add and edit tags for any course and all courses for an instructor.  

You can grant full proxy access by selecting Full Proxy Users from the Instructor Tools menu, located on the left side of the page.  On the page that follows, add proxy users by adding their campus connect username and selecting Add Proxy User.  

Note:  All users must first have accounts in the system before they can be added as proxy users.  Users can create an account by logging in to Course Reserves

Add a Course Proxy User

Course Reserves also allows instructors to grant course proxy access to another user.  Any user with course proxy access will be able to request course reserves, edit reserves, add and edit tags for the single course that they were grants course proxy access for.    

 

You can grant course proxy access by first selecting a course, then choosing Course Proxy Users from the Instructor Course Tools menu, located on the left side of the page.  On the page that follows, add proxy users by adding their campus connect username and selecting Add Proxy User.  

Note:  As with full proxy users, all users must first have accounts in the Ares system before they can be added as proxy users.  Users can create an account by logging in to Course Reserves
